Rf Filter Engineer information

What does an RF filter engineer do?

An RF Filter Engineer specializes in designing, developing, and testing radio frequency (RF) filters used in wireless communication systems. These filters play a critical role in allowing certain frequencies to pass while blocking unwanted signals, which helps improve the performance and reliability of devices like smartphones, radios, and radar systems. RF Filter Engineers work with various filter technologies, such as SAW (Surface Acoustic Wave), BAW (Bulk Acoustic Wave), and LC filters, to meet specific requirements for different applications. Their responsibilities often include simulation, prototyping, and collaborating with other engineers to integrate filters into larger systems.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an RF filter engineer?

To thrive as an RF Filter Engineer, you need a strong background in electrical engineering, signal processing, and RF circuit design, usually supported by a relevant degree. Familiarity with simulation tools like ADS, HFSS, or CST, and knowledge of industry standards and testing equipment are typically required. Analytical thinking, problem-solving, and effective communication help distinguish top performers in collaborative and fast-paced environments. These skills are vital for designing reliable RF filters that meet performance specifications, ensuring optimal operation in wireless communication systems.

What are some common challenges faced by RF filter engineers during the product development cycle?

RF Filter Engineers often encounter challenges such as meeting strict performance specifications while minimizing size and cost, and addressing issues like signal interference and insertion loss. Collaboration with cross-functional teams, such as PCB designers and RF system engineers, is crucial to ensure that filters integrate seamlessly into larger systems. Additionally, rapid prototyping and testing are required to optimize designs for manufacturability and scalability, which can be demanding under tight project timelines.

Job description

Job Title: RF Filter Design Engineer
Department: Design Engineer
Reports to: Director of Engineering
Job Class: Exempt (Salary)
Pay Rate: Dependent upon experience
Location: Orlando, FL (On-site)
Position Summary:
This position is responsible for the design and development of RF and Microwave filter products. Leads project teams in a fast-paced team environment to deliver new products to customers on time, meeting or exceeding all requirements and resulting in profitable products when transitioned to production.
Job Duties and Responsibilities:
  • Apply technical principles of engineering and electronics and utilize RF synthesis and simulation software packages to design, simulate and prototype new products with emphasis in RF filters.
  • Perform detailed analysis of compliance for electrical, mechanical, environmental and regulatory requirements (compliance matrix) for all new products being quoted.
  • Estimate total costs, including material, labor, test and development costs as well as lead time for new products to be quoted.
  • Lead design and development projects to completion following the company's documented design and development process.
  • Optimize new products for performance, lead time and cost.
  • Provide guidance to assemblers and engineering technicians during the prototype build and optimization phase.
  • Interface with Manufacturing Engineering to develop any new processes required to support new products.
  • Interface with purchasing department to ensure required materials for prototypes are procured and delivered on time.
  • Provide timely updates on progress of projects.
  • Lead and/or participate in required project meetings: Project kick-offs, peer design reviews, pre-ship reviews, etc...
  • Provide necessary design engineering support during transition of new products to production.
  • Support mature products already in production that need design engineering support for obsolete components, quality or reliability issues or further optimization.
  • Educate, train, mentor and coach other design engineers and technicians that have less experience or knowledge in the field.
  • Stay up to date on technology and industry trends and propose new products to management that can give company a competitive advantage.

Supervises: None
Knowledge, Skills, & Abilities:
  • Familiarity in Microsoft Office Applications such as Microsoft Word, Excel, and Power Point is required.
  • Working knowledge of RF/Microwave filter synthesis and simulation software, with experience in lumped-element and/or distributed-element designs.
  • Understanding of technologies and processes used in the design and fabrication of filters and related RF products.
  • Strong project management capabilities.
  • Excellent communication skills with the ability to collaborate effectively in a fast-paced engineering and production environment.
  • Hands-on bench skills.
  • Knowledge of various lumped-element filter topologies and design methodologies.
  • Experience with cavity and dielectric resonator filters used in telecommunications, military, or avionics applications.
  • Experience designing high-power filters (300 watts or greater) and/or filter miniaturization.
  • Strong CAD skills with electromagnetic analysis tools.
  • Understanding of radio architecture, avionics and military communication systems, and radar systems.
  • Must be able to work with ITAR data without a license.

Education, Experience and Training:
  • Bachelor's or Master Degre in Electrical Engineer (BSEE or MSEE preferred).
  • 10+ years of experience in RF/Microwave industry, including a minimum of 5 years in filter design.
  • Experience with integrated microwave filter assemblies is preferred.
